The wheels are Axis SuperMesh.....19x8.5 and 19x9.5
Axis no longer makes this wheel. I think it is one of the best looking mesh designs....ever. there's just something about the proportions.
Axis has replaced it with the Penta.

Springs are tein 350Z H-techs.

tires are Yokahama AVS Sports 245/35s & 275/30s.

I haven't had it aligned yet. There may be some rubbing if you go back to origianl camber specs.

I have a slight change to make in the rear, and I won't have any troubles.
